“…One example is the release of a self-quenched carboxyfluorescein or calcein probe that is incorporated in lipid vesicles and released due to leakage of the vesicle [40,272]. Using fluorescence spectroscopy, the release can be monitored over time [40,273]. Other strategies rely on microscopy using inverted optical microscopy for giant unilamellar vesicles (GUVs) or atomic force microscopy (AFM) for supported lipid bilayers [265,274].…”

“…It is interpreted by the fact that dodecaborate act as hydrophilic but superchaotropic anion in water solution. 30,[44][45][46][47] It means that water is less structured and more "lipophilic" around such anions as compared to bulk water. Association of chaotropes with cyclodextrins is explained not in terms of hydrophobic action but as so-called chaotropic effect because it is enthalpy driven.…”
